Aurora Domes

The Aurora Domes is a facility operated by the owners of the Tundra Inn, and is used to observe the Aurora Borealis in the comfort of your shirt sleeves. The domes were constructed for this express purpose and were used by scientists when the Churchill Research Range was operational.

This facility is 3 miles past the Airport and away from the lights of the town, situated on the Tundra, adjacent to the Taiga. Viewing is usually over a 4 or 5 hour period, beginning around 7:30 or 8:00 P.M. and ending around 12:00 to 1:00 A.M., depending on the amount of Aurora.

While awaiting the Aurora, videos, books and a light snack and beverages are available. Best viewing times are in January, February and March.
